Step 1
Preheat grill to Medium-High and brush grill grates with oil.
Step 2
In a saucepan set over medium heat, combine soy sauce, sesame oil, garlic, and sugar; whisk and bring to a simmer, stirring frequently, until it begins to thicken. Remove from heat. Set aside.
Step 3
Cut the zucchini into long 1/4-inch thick strips.
Step 4
Place zucchini on the hot grill in one single layer.
Step 5
Close the lid and cook for 3 minutes.
Step 6
Using tongs, flip over the zucchini; cover and continue to cook for 2 to 3 more minutes, or until charred and tender. Remove from heat.
Step 7
Remove from heat and brush each slice of zucchini with the sauce.
Step 8
Garnish with sesame seeds and pepper flakes. Serve.
